Табуляция в Microsoft Excel — это не просто отступ, а мощный инструмент для структурирования данных. В отличие от Word, где табуляция используется для создания столбцов текста, в Excel она помогает выравнивать содержимое ячеек, формировать многоуровневые списки и даже управлять отображением формул. Но стандартные настройки (обычно 0,63 см) редко подходят для сложных таблиц.
Проблема в том, что большинство пользователей даже не подозревают о возможности настройки табуляции — просто нажимают Tab и получают хаотичные отступы. Между тем, правильная настройка позволяет:
- 📏 Выравнивать текст в ячейках по нестандартным позициям (например, для создания кастомных таблиц без границ)
- 📑 Форматировать многоуровневые списки с точными отступами
- 🔄 Управлять отображением формул с отступами для лучшей читаемости
- 🖼️ Подготавливать данные для экспорта в другие программы (например, в Adobe InDesign)
В этой статье — 5 проверенных способов изменить табуляцию в Excel (актуально для версий 2013–2026 и Microsoft 365), включая скрытые настройки и обходные пути для специфических задач. А в конце — FAQ с ответами на самые частые ошибки.
1. Стандартный способ: настройка табуляции через линейку
Самый очевидный, но самый ограниченный метод. Работает только в режиме разметки страницы (Вид → Разметка страницы) и влияет исключительно на текущий лист.
Как настроить:
- Переключитесь на вкладку
Види выберитеРазметка страницы. - Если линейка не видна, включите её:
Вид → Показать → Линейка. - Щёлкните левой кнопкой мыши на верхней линейке (горизонтальной) в том месте, где хотите установить табуляцию. Появится маркер L.
- Перетащите маркер на нужную позицию (значение отобразится при наведении).
⚠️ Внимание: Этот метод не работает для ячеек с переносом текста (Главная → Перенос текста). Табуляция будет игнорироваться, если ширина ячейки меньше установленного отступа.
| Действие | Результат | Ограничения |
|---|---|---|
| Установка одного маркера | Текст будет привязан к одной позиции | Нельзя задать несколько табуляций для одной ячейки |
Удержание Ctrl + клик |
Добавление дополнительных маркеров | Максимум 15 маркеров на лист |
| Перетаскивание маркера за пределы листа | Удаление табуляции | Не влияет на уже введённый текст |
2. Изменение табуляции через параметры страницы
Этот способ подходит, если вам нужно единообразно настроить отступы для печати или экспорта в PDF. Здесь табуляция привязывается к полям страницы.
Инструкция:
- Перейдите на вкладку
Разметка страницы(илиФайл → Печать). - Нажмите
Поля→Настраиваемые поля. - В разделе Отступы укажите значения для
СлеваиСверху— они будут использоваться как базовые для табуляции. - Нажмите
ОКи вернитесь в режимОбычный.
🔹 Нюанс: Этот метод косвенно влияет на табуляцию — Excel будет использовать заданные отступы как "точки привязки" при нажатии Tab. Например, если вы установите левое поле 2 см, то первый отступ табуляции будет кратен этому значению.
Как проверить текущие настройки полей?
Откройте Файл → Печать — в предварительном просмотре отобразятся серые линии полей. Также можно увидеть точные значения в Разметка страницы → Поля → Настраиваемые поля.
3. Использование символа табуляции в формулах
Мало кто знает, но в Excel можно вставлять символ табуляции прямо в формулы для форматирования вывода. Это полезно, например, для создания отчётов с выравниванием данных.
Примеры:
- 📌 В формуле:
=ТЕКСТ(A1; "0,00") & СИМВОЛ(9) & "руб."(где
СИМВОЛ(9)— это табуляция) - 📌 В функции
СЦЕПИТЬ:=СЦЕПИТЬ("Итого: "; СИМВОЛ(9); СУММ(B2:B10))
⚠️ Внимание: Символ табуляции в формулах будет виден только при объединении ячеек или если включен режим Перенос текста. В обычной ячейке он отобразится как пустое пространство.
Каждый день|Несколько раз в неделю|Рядом не стоял|Только для печати-->
4. Настройка табуляции через VBA (для продвинутых)
Если вам нужно автоматизировать настройку табуляции для сотен ячеек, поможет VBA-скрипт. Например, этот код установит отступ 1,5 см для всех выделенных ячеек:
Sub SetTabStop()
With Selection
.HorizontalAlignment = xlLeft
.IndentLevel = 2 ' Уровень отступа (0-15)
End With
End Sub
Как использовать: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- Вставьте код в новый модуль (
Insert → Module). - Вернитесь в Excel, выделите нужные ячейки и запустите макрос (
Alt + F8).
🔹 Плюс метода: Можно привязать макрос к кнопке на панели быстрого доступа или сочетанию клавиш.
Сохранить файл как .xlsm (с поддержкой макросов)|Включить разработчика (Файл → Параметры → Настроить ленту)|Проверить настройки безопасности макросов|Сделать резервную копию данных-->
5. Обходной путь: замена табуляции на пробелы
Если стандартные методы не работают (например, в Excel Online), можно эмулировать табуляцию с помощью функции ПОВТОР:
=ПОВТОР(" "; 8) & A1
Где 8 — количество пробелов (подберите визуально). Этот способ удобен для:
- 📊 Выравнивания данных в сводных таблицах
- 📄 Подготовки текста для экспорта в Word или Google Docs
- 🖥️ Работы в веб-версии Excel, где нет линейки
⚠️ Внимание: При копировании таких данных в другие программы пробелы могут сжиматься. Чтобы этого избежать, используйте неразрывные пробелы (СИМВОЛ(160)):
=ПОВТОР(СИМВОЛ(160); 8) & A1
6. Специфические случаи: табуляция в сводных таблицах и Power Query
В сводных таблицах и Power Query стандартная табуляция не работает. Здесь нужны другие подходы:
Для сводных таблиц:
- 🔄 Используйте
Параметры сводной таблицы → Макет → Отображать элементы в виде таблицы— это автоматически добавит отступы для вложенных элементов. - 🎨 Примените условное форматирование с отступами для разных уровней группировки.
В Power Query:
- 🔗 Добавьте пользовательский столбец с формулой
= Text.PadStart([Column1], 10)(где10— желаемая ширина). - 📝 Используйте
Text.Replaceдля замены табуляций на фиксированные отступы перед загрузкой данных.
Частые ошибки и их решения
Даже после настройки табуляции пользователи сталкиваются с проблемами. Вот TOP-5 ошибок и как их исправить:
| Проблема | Причина | Решение |
|---|---|---|
| Табуляция не работает в объединённых ячейках | Excel игнорирует отступы в слияниях | Разделите ячейки или используйте пробелы |
| Отступы сбиваются при экспорте в PDF | Настройки печати не совпадают с экранными | Проверьте Файл → Печать → Параметры страницы |
| Табуляция превращается в точки в Word | Копирование с переносом форматирования | Вставляйте как Только текст (Ctrl+Shift+V) |
| Маркеры табуляции не сохраняются | Файл сохранён в формате .csv или .txt | Сохраните как .xlsx или .xlsm |
Критическая особенность: В Excel для Mac линейка отображается только в режиме Макет страницы, а маркеры табуляции могут "прилипать" к сетке документа. Чтобы этого избежать, отключите привязку: Excel → Настройки → Правка → Отменить привязку к сетке.
FAQ: Ответы на популярные вопросы
Можно ли сделать разную табуляцию для разных листов?
Да, настройки табуляции через линейку (Разметка страницы) применяются только к текущему листу. Для других листов придётся настраивать отдельно.
Почему после нажатия Tab курсор переходит на следующую ячейку, а не делает отступ?
По умолчанию Tab используется для навигации между ячейками. Чтобы вставить символ табуляции внутри ячейки, нажмите Alt + Tab (в Windows) или Option + Tab (на Mac).
Как убрать все табуляции в документе?
Используйте функцию НАЙТИ и ЗАМЕНИТЬ (Ctrl+H): в поле "Найти" вставьте символ табуляции (нажмите Tab), поле "Заменить на" оставьте пустым. Внимание: это удалит все отступы, включая полезные!
Можно ли настроить табуляцию для формул в строке формул?
Нет, в строке формул (Fx) табуляция работает только как навигационная клавиша. Для форматирования кода используйте Alt+Enter для переноса строк.
Почему при копировании в Word отступы исчезают?
Word по умолчанию игнорирует табуляцию Excel. Чтобы сохранить форматирование, экспортируйте лист в PDF, а затем конвертируйте в Word через Adobe Acrobat или онлайн-конвертеры.